Official Shutter Lifespan vs Reality: How Long Does a Camera Actually Last?

The number on the spec sheet and the number in real life

Every Nikon camera comes with an official shutter rating — 100,000, 150,000, or 300,000 actuations. But what do these numbers actually mean? And why do I sometimes see D850 bodies with 450,000 clicks that still shoot cleanly, while a D5600 dies at 110,000?

After 14 years in the workshop, here's what I actually know.

How manufacturers determine the rated lifespan

The official rating is a MTBF figure — Mean Time Between Failures, derived from laboratory testing. Nikon fires the shutter at room temperature, at a controlled rate, with a specific type of load. The number at which 50% of test units have experienced a failure becomes the rated lifespan.

In the real world, conditions are very different. Cold weather thickens lubricants. Hot weather accelerates wear. High-speed burst shooting stresses the mechanism differently than single-shot.

Real-world data from my workshop

Camera Model Official Rating Real-World Average (Workshop Observation)
Nikon D850 200,000 280,000–400,000+
Nikon D750 150,000 170,000–250,000
Nikon D7200 150,000 130,000–200,000
Nikon D5600 100,000 80,000–130,000
Nikon D5 400,000 400,000–600,000

What actually determines longevity

  • Operating temperature: Cold is harder on lubricants; heat increases wear rates.
  • Shooting style: Long burst sequences at 8–12 fps heat the shutter mechanism significantly more than single-shot portrait work.
  • Lens weight: Heavy telephoto lenses create more mechanical stress on the shutter during mirror slap.
  • Maintenance history: A camera that was serviced and cleaned regularly will outlast a neglected one every time.
